Position Summary

Join a team of enterprise architects that drive innovation, collaboration and alignment for the CVS Health platform that enables CVS’s vision of helping people on their path to better health. Enable and execute on the enterprise architecture blueprint strategy through engagements, collaboration, and partnership across technology.

What you will do

  • Be part of a team responsible for enabling the technology solutions that meets our business strategy and drives business value.

  • Define and collaborate on the creation of roadmaps, architectures, standards, best practice documents and starter code reference implementations that will accelerate delivery for our technology teams to execute on the future direction of CVS Health including a focus on applied AI.

  • Evaluate market trends, execute buy vs. build decisions and assess cost and the impact on targeted business outcomes.

  • Define future state architecture that enables and adopts the strategy for Artificial Intelligence, APIs, data stores, cloud infrastructures, cloud services, and microservices.

  • Collaborate and consult with technology and business partners to optimize business applications and systems that adopt modern architecture and technologies especially around AI.

  • Develop and maintain a strategic vision to support capabilities aligned to the CVS Health platform based on key business drivers and technology trends.

  • Define and collaborate on the creation of frameworks for the enterprise that promote reuse, reduces cost, manages risk, and increases speed to market.

  • Effectively build and maintain strong relationships with technology and business partners to establish trust and influence key business outcomes and decisions.

  • Provide guidance, direction and mentorship to engineers and other stakeholders regarding the architecture and design of the respective applications.

  • Ensure all Non-Functional Requirements (e.g. performance, availability and fail-over, scalability, security, etc.) are properly articulated, and work with all parties to guarantee that the software products that are delivered meet these objectives.

  • Participates in high-level estimation.

  • Mentor and coach junior architects and seek the opportunity to bring in continuous improvements to implement.

Required Qualifications:

  • 15+ years of relevant work experience (8+ years in architecture)

  • 10+ years of experience building large scale business applications using modern technologies and architecture.

  • 10+ years of experience designing complex integrations with a focus on performance engineering and loose coupling using APIs, microservices, and event-driven architecture.

  • 8+ years of experience and proficiency with modern languages, frameworks, and technologies.

  • 6+ years of experience facilitating implementation of north star architectures by delivery teams through mentoring and building POCs, starter code, and other collaborative activities.

  • Expert-level understanding of architectural methodologies/best practices, business climate, and/or regulation that affect architecture decisions.

  • Recognized technical leader with full stack technology knowledge and recognized as an expert in one or more technical subjects.

  • Experience recognizing the impact architectural approaches can have on strategic business decisions.

  • Substantial experience with requirements analysis, estimation, systems and application design, and testing.

  • Experience with defining architecture using the C4 model or equivalent with a focus on system context, container, and component diagrams.

  • Expert understanding of architectural methodologies and the development of standards, architectural governance, design patterns and best practices.

  • A diverse technical background with key areas of depth around AI/ML/Agentic AI, cloud, data platforms, hybrid solutions and operating at scale.

  • Experience with requirements analysis, estimation, systems design, and application design.

  • Excellent collaboration, influencing, negotiation, coaching and coalition-building skills.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ience developing architecture using agile methodology or SAFe practices.

  • Experience in AI architecture and practical application of AI technologies.

  • Experience with the concepts and practical application of Generative AI, Agentic AI, the future of Ambient Agents and beyond.

  • A self-starter that is naturally inquisitive.

Education

Bachelor’s degree in computer science or related field.
